They can be found in various sizes and types, with the most typical dimensions being 20 feet and 40 feet. Nevertheless, the 30 ft container provides an intermediate service, offering benefits for specific shipping and storage needs.<br>Dimensions of a 30 Ft Container<br>Here are the specs of a basic 30 ft container:<br>DimensionMetric (m)Imperial (ft)External Length9.14 m30 ftExternal Width2.44 m8 ftExternal Height2.59 m8.5 ftInternal Length9.00 m29.5 ftInternal Width2.35 m7.7 ftInternal Height2.39 m7.9 ftMaximum Payload26,000 kg57,320 poundsVolume66.2 m ³ 2,335 ft three External vs. Internal DimensionsExternal dimensions refer to the total size of the container, consisting of the building and construction structure, while internal dimensions explain the functional area within the container. Understanding these differences is necessary for preparing how much cargo can be packed. Retail Use: Ideal for pop-up stores or temporary screensat special events or festivals. Regularly Asked Questions(FAQs)Q1: What is the weight limit of a 30 ft container? A: A typical 30 ft containerhas a maximum payload of roughly 26,000 kg, or 57,320 lbs. Q2: How much does a 30 ft container weigh? A: The tare weight of a basic 30 ftcontainer is usually around 2,300 kg, or about 5,000 lbs, which can differ a little based on the container'smaterial and construction. Q3: Are 30ft containers offered for lease? A: Yes, both rental and purchasechoices are available for 30 ft containers through shipping and logistics business. Q4: Can a 30 ft container be delivered globally? A: Yes, they can be used for worldwide shipping, subject to the policies of the countries included in the transportation. Q5: What is the distinction between a standard container and a high-cube container? A: A high-cube container is 1 ft taller than a basic container<br>, offering it more internal space.
